Impact of lemon peels phenolic extract on the oestrus cycle and uterine histoarchitecture in female wistar albino rats
Abstract
Infertility is a significant clinical concern, affecting a good percentage of females of reproductive age. Obesity and overweight have been identified as contributing factors to infertility in most cases. Lemon polyphenols have been reported to suppress body weight gain and body fat accumulation, making lemon a commonly consumed fruit among women of all ages for body weight management. While the effects of lemon on body weight are well-studied, the impact of continuous lemon intake on different body systems and organs is still being explored. In this study, we aimed to investigate the effects of the phenolic extract of lemon peels on the oestrus cycle and the histological features of the uterus following the consumption of varied dosages of lemon peel phenolic extract. A total of 24 female Wistar albino rats weighing between 180-250 g were randomly split into four groups (n = 6 per group). Group 1 served as the control group and was given only distilled water and rat pellets for a period of 14 days, while groups 2, 3, and 4 were administered 200 mg/kg, 400 mg/kg, and 600 mg/kg body weight of phenolic extract of lemon peels, respectively, for the same period. The effect of the extract on the body weight, pattern of oestrus cycle, and histological morphological differences between the uteri of the control and treatment groups were evaluated.
